Output 6516635fc615530b4b557cf1315ee1aa418bb351c2d617bcbf5f512976e62090:0

value
84856198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be986bfabc58726e02940da51177394f040d3a8a OP_EQUALVERIFY OP_CHECKSIG
address
1JNmyuBiSFEDdHmRuoTpHJFrdfUzTDoBnS
transaction
6516635fc615530b4b557cf1315ee1aa418bb351c2d617bcbf5f512976e62090
spent
true